Ajman University contributed to the Ajman Sewerage NextGen Innovators Competition 2025, reinforcing its commitment to sustainability-focused education and youth engagement. The University’s involvement reflects its ongoing efforts to support initiatives that encourage innovation, environmental responsibility, and real-world problem solving.
Organized by Ajman Sewerage, the competition brought together school students to develop creative, technology-driven solutions addressing key challenges related to water management, environmental protection, and community wellbeing. The initiative aligned with national sustainability priorities and provided students with a platform to translate ideas into practical applications.
The competition concluded with final presentations and an awards ceremony held at the Ajman Saray Ballroom on 21 November 2025, bringing together student innovators, judges, and key stakeholders. Outstanding teams were recognized with cash prizes, medals, and certificates, including awards for the top three teams and the best presenter, in recognition of their creativity and solution feasibility.
Ajman University was represented on the judging panel by Ms. Maya Haddad, Senior Sustainability Manager, contributing the University’s sustainability expertise to the evaluation of student proposals and reinforcing its role in supporting applied learning and community collaboration.
